Mono-green isn't a reliable control color, but there is always the surety that if Dosan is out then your opponent's responses become extremely limited.This deck is designed to ramp extremely quickly, then shoot for a turn where you drop Dosan and win the game with an infinite combo.In the mean time, dump all your creatures out and refill your hand with Collective Unconscious/Shamanic Revelation/Rishkar's Expertise.Combos Include:Marwyn/Karametra/Magus/Priest/Wirewood + Staff/SwordAshaya + Argothian/MagusArgothian/Magus + Lands w/ Enchantments + Staff/SwordDump mana into Kamahl/Ezuri to finish opponents.=================================================================Main problem is getting the artifact combo pieces...there isn't one. You just have to draw into them or go with an Ashaya combo. But at least there are many tutors in green to fetch the creature pieces.It's also difficult to interact with opponents over time, mainly hate pieces to slow opponents down before we win. Would be nice if there was a way to prevent opponents from drawing multiple cards.Your boardstate is vulnerable to boardwipes.However, because it's mono-green your game is going to be really consistent. You can expect to be 3-4 lands ahead of your opponents by midgame and probably further ahead tempo-wise because of hate pieces. With the right hate piece you might be able to lock them out of the game altogether.=================================================================This is at best a B tier deck, but it performs consistently at B. If you want to do more mono-green control play Yisan. If you want more big mana combos try Marwyn/Selvala/Ashaya as the commander.
